Q: Is 605,652 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 605,652 is not a prime number.

Why is 605,652 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 605652 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 12 41 82 123 164 246 492 1,231 2,462 3,693 4,924 7,386 14,772 50,471 100,942 151,413 201,884 302,826 and 605,652, with no remainder.

Since 605,652 cannot be divided by just 1 and 605,652, it is not a prime number.
